101 Battery Road, London
Reg Number: 12473740
Date of Inc: February 20, 2020
111 BATTERY ROAD, LONDON
Reg Number: 12254207
Date of Inc: October 10, 2019
113 Battery Road, London
Reg Number: 13824487
Date of Inc: January 01, 2022